The overarching narrative of Season 6 is shaped by the fallout of Finn's first meeting with his biological father, .
: In the two-part season premiere " Wake Up " and " Escape from the Citadel " , Finn and Jake journey to a cosmic prison to find Martin. Instead of a hero, Finn finds a selfish, uncaring fugitive.
